So there I was, disassembling the rear suspension and everything was going real smooth.. almost to easy that I was expecting something. Well when something goes wrong it just had to be the toughest (in my opinion) bolt to extract in the entire frame.

http://store.delorean.com/c-354-5-3-0-rear-suspension.aspx

Bolt #15 here, it backed out a few turns, then snapped. Any suggestions on how to remove?

Best course of action is to drill and tap the location. This is one of the worst places that it can happen. The bolt is 1/2 20 for reference on reassembly. Do you have the body off the frame? Getting on this straight is rather important as it will bind the upper control arm if installed wrong.

I would also stay away from helicoils etc as they will not have the holding strength required in this location.
